About the author.
Oluwabusola is an enabler who is passionate about deploying innovation and design thinking as problem-solving tools to harness the economic potential of individuals and companies. She emphasizes the need to start from an empathy standpoint in solving grand challenges. She has experience interfacing with startups and education stakeholders. She founded Steering for Greatness Foundation, a youth-led NGO with the goal of providing relevant education for African teens, children, and teachers by introducing them to design thinking and experiential learning practices.
Through her foundation, she instituted a Leadership, Entrepreneurship, and Technology Boot Camp where teenagers receive training on 21st-century skills and vocational training, servant leadership, advocacy, coding, etc. The Boot Camp has directly impacted 250 teenagers and 1500 indirectly leveraging technology. Some participants have gone on to choose entrepreneurship as a career path.
Oluwabusola also initiated a Future Readiness Tour and a Teachers training program that has empowered 2000 Secondary School Students and 200 teachers, respectively. In response to the Fourth Industrial Revolution, she also initiated the Future of Work Summit, with attendees and speakers from over ten countries. She is an enthusiastic, innovative economist cum educator. She is also a co-founder at Yetar Virtual CFOs Limited, where she leads operations in tax, accounting and business advisory for SMEs.
